Which components are found at the lowest level of the data object hierarchy in Databricks?

Study for the Databricks Fundamentals Exam. Prepare with flashcards and multiple choice questions, each complete with hints and explanations. Ensure your success on the test!

The lowest level of the data object hierarchy in Databricks is represented by tables, views, and volumes. These components are essential for storing and managing data.

Tables serve as the primary structure where data is stored, consisting of rows and columns that organize the information effectively. Views are virtual tables that provide a way to present data from one or more tables with customized queries, offering flexibility in how data is accessed and manipulated without altering the underlying tables. Volumes, on the other hand, enable the organization and storage of large datasets in a persistent format, facilitating easier data access and management in a scalable manner.

This hierarchy emphasizes the fundamental aspects of data management in Databricks, illustrating that these components are foundational building blocks for higher-level abstractions like databases and catalogs, which organize and contain these tables and views. Thus, identifying tables, views, and volumes as the lowest level correctly reflects how data is managed and structured within Databricks.
